Chocolate Peanut Butter Cups

Delightful homemade Chocolate Peanut Butter Cups featuring a creamy peanut filling encased in smooth chocolate. A nostalgic treat that’s easy to make!

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up of chocolate chips
  • 1/2 cup of peanut butter
  • 1/4 cup of powdered s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on of vanilla extract
  • Paper cupcake liners

Instructions

  1. Line a muffin tin with paper cupcake liners.
  2. Melt the chocolate chips until smooth in a microwave-safe bowl.
  3. Spoon a small amount of melted chocolate into each liner to create a base.
  4. Mix the peanut butter,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ract until well combined.
  5. Place a spoonful of peanut butter mixture on top of the chocolate base in each liner.
  6. Cover the peanut butter layer with more melted chocolate.
  7.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or until set.
  8. Enjoy your homemade chocolate peanut butter cups!

Notes

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to a week or freeze for up to 3 months.
